Joost Mulders wrote: >> Could we introduce below property into Brussels while keeping current >> IEEE802.3 defination? Having a property named "ether-flow-ctrl", which has >> below possible values: >> >> ether-flow-ctrl = 0: Disable pause frame flow control >> ether-flow-ctrl = 1: Enable just Rx flow control >> ether-flow-ctrl = 2: Enable just Tx flow control >> ether-flow-ctrl = 3: Enable both Rx/Tx flow control >> > > Interesting reading on this subject: > http://hardware.mcse.ms/message13052.html > > Flow control per direction is a far better concept than what we offer > now. I would love to see it implemented. > > Regards, Joost > I think we need a friendly UI for pause setting, while keeping the ieee802.3 tunable as many as possible. I wonder some users may really tweak these value, isn't it?
